Men’s skin: a personalized approach

We all want healthy skin, but the journey looks a little different for everyone. Men’s skin, for example, tends to be more coarse and flower than women – with around 20% more thickness and a higher collagen density, which can keep the appearance youthful for longer. Lucky.

Taking this, men often face specific challenges, such as shaving irritation, flower or sun damage. Building a simple but effective skin care routine can help to deal with these concerns and support the long-term skin health-it does not require 10 steps.

Your questions about skin care for men replied

How do I choose skin care for men based on skin type?

  • Skin Strip: Look for Mattifying products and light gel textures.
  • Dry skin: Moisturizing creams or lotions with ingredients such as urea or hyaluronic acid work well.
  • Combined skin: A moisturizing balancing cream can help manage oil and land.
  • Sensitive skin: Choose soft formulas with soothing ingredients such as vitamin E or niainamide.

What are the main steps in a skin care routine for men?

Keep it simple. Start with the three basics:

  1. Cleanser: Rinse the oil, dirt and dirt.
  2. Moisturizing cream: Moisturize and protect the skin barrier.
  3. Sunscreen: Defend UV rays and other environmental agents while fighting signs of premature aging.

Is it a good idea to give the skin to someone who has no routine?

Absolutely. A stochastic gift of skin care can be the perfect way to encourage one to start taking care of their skin-especially if it is a low-reward, high-reward product such as sunscreen.

Can I give a skin, even if I don’t know much about it?

Yes! Choose products that make up dermatologists, beginner -friendly products or sets of skin care that fit all skin types. Travel sizes or discovery kits are also safe bets.
